Step 3: Shape and store the almond paste. Traditionally almond paste (and marzipan) and stored rolled up in a log. To do this, transfer the paste to a sheet of beeswax wrap, parchment paper, or clingfilm. Fold the paper/film over the mixture and use it to help you shape a log.

Coat the eggs. Carefully dip each almond butter egg into the melted chocolate, using a fork to allow the excess chocolate to run off. Set the coated eggs back onto the parchment paper and repeat. Use any leftover chocolate to drizzle over the top of the eggs. Chill: Transfer to the fridge and allow to chill for 30-35 minutes or until hardened.

Instructions. Crack the eggs into a medium bowl and add the almond milk. Whisk until combined. Brush a small nonstick skillet with olive oil. Bring to medium heat. Pour in the eggs, and let them cook for a few seconds without stirring. When the eggs begin to set, start mixing them until you have large chunky pieces.

Egg has more Copper, Selenium, and Vitamin B12, however, Almond is richer in Vitamin E , Manganese, Magnesium, Fiber, Vitamin B2, and Phosphorus. Almond covers your daily Vitamin E needs 164% more than Egg. Specific food types used in this comparison are Egg, whole, cooked, hard-boiled and Nuts, almonds.
